About the Instructor
Ms. Chua Pei Shan | Associate Lecturer, Republic Polytechnic
Ms. Chua Pei Shan is a fully registered Physiotherapist under Singapore’s Allied Health Professional Council with over 13 years of experience spanning community hospitals, eldercare, and home hospice care. She blends Western Physiotherapy with Traditional Chinese Medicine (Tui Na) to deliver holistic and effective treatments tailored to her clients’ needs. A strong advocate for preventive healthcare, she actively contributes through YouTube videos, public talks, and workshops. Currently an associate lecturer at Republic Polytechnic, she also holds a Postgraduate Diploma in Counselling Psychology, enabling her to address biopsychosocial and spiritual aspects of care while transforming lives through comprehensive rehabilitation.
